Yield Farming Sustainability

Yield farming sustainability is the ability of a protocol to maintain its promised returns to liquidity providers over the long term without compromising its financial health. Many protocols initially attract users through high yields funded by token emissions, which may not be sustainable once those emissions decrease.

Sustainability depends on the protocol's ability to generate real revenue from fees or other activities that can support the yield without relying solely on token inflation. Analysts evaluate this by looking at the ratio of revenue generated to the yield distributed to participants.

Protocols that can demonstrate a path to self-sufficiency are generally viewed as more stable and attractive for long-term investment. Understanding this is vital for participants who want to avoid protocols that may collapse when incentive structures change.
